Do not hard-code guest_base at 32GB.
Do not override mmap_next_start for reserved_va.
Signed-off-by: Richard Henderson <richard.henderson@linaro.org>
---
Hi Warner,
With the blitz-trial branch you provided, the host libc allocates
thread-local storage within the [32GB, 36GB) region that you currently
assume is free.
The armv7-hello program happens to map on top of this thread-local
storage, and then we crash later accessing some host TLS variable.
While the linux-user probe_guest_base is significantly more complex,
we are also trying to handle 32-bit hosts. I think freebsd is always
assuming 64-bit hosts, which makes this simpler.

I think freebsd is always > assuming 64-bit hosts, which makes this simpler. > Double mapping makes sense for problems to arise. I'd not have thought this would be the problem, but it does eliminate a bunch of code that I'd thought suspect (made worse by my trying to 'fix' old kludges with new kludges of my own). Yes. FreeBSD's bsd-user binary will only run on 64-bit hosts. The project has started phasing out support for 32-bit hosts, and the role of bsd-user (package builder tool) is such that 32-bit hosts don't make sense. I've tested this out, and it works for me.
